From: "Milton D. Miller II" <miltonm@us.ibm.com>
The sram reg and name properties were missing a zero. It was more
obvious when looking at the platform device names which put the address
before the generic name.
Signed-off-by: Milton Miller <miltonm@us.ibm.com>
---
arch/arm/boot/dts/ast2400.dtsi | 4 ++--
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/ast2400.dtsi b/arch/arm/boot/dts/ast2400.dtsi
index 24e7235..21f4875 100644
---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/ast2400.dtsi
+++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/ast2400.dtsi
@@ -79,9 +79,9 @@
#size-cells = <1>;
ranges;
- sram@1e72000 {
+ sram@1e720000 {
compatible = "mmio-sram";
- reg = <0x1e72000 0x8000>; // 32K
+ reg = <0x1e720000 0x8000>; // 32K
};
